summaryrefslogtreecommitdiff
path: root/js/Linear/SUMMATION.js
diff options
context:
space:
mode:
authorSunil Shetye2018-07-09 17:07:46 +0530
committerSunil Shetye2018-07-10 11:24:53 +0530
commitf19304a4fe99556c5ddc35024c818d00ffe7e23a (patch)
treef795b52492d1962f66c2f84f575ce5074b0668a8 /js/Linear/SUMMATION.js
parentcbc375d9bc42bc29eeb919a020dfbf15921d3cf0 (diff)
downloadsci2js-f19304a4fe99556c5ddc35024c818d00ffe7e23a.tar.gz
sci2js-f19304a4fe99556c5ddc35024c818d00ffe7e23a.tar.bz2
sci2js-f19304a4fe99556c5ddc35024c818d00ffe7e23a.zip
handle list separately
Diffstat (limited to 'js/Linear/SUMMATION.js')
-rw-r--r--js/Linear/SUMMATION.js42
1 files changed, 21 insertions, 21 deletions
diff --git a/js/Linear/SUMMATION.js b/js/Linear/SUMMATION.js
index ec0683cf..996168f6 100644
--- a/js/Linear/SUMMATION.js
+++ b/js/Linear/SUMMATION.js
@@ -3,7 +3,7 @@ function SUMMATION() {
SUMMATION.prototype.define = function SUMMATION() {
this.sgn = [[1],[-1]];
this.model = scicos_model();
- this.model.sim = list("summation",4);
+ this.model.sim = list(new ScilabString("summation"),new ScilabDouble(4));
this.model.in1 = [[-1],[-1]];
this.model.out = new ScilabDouble(-1);
this.model.in2 = [[-2],[-2]];
@@ -81,54 +81,54 @@ function SUMMATION() {
it = this.Datatype*ones(1,size(in1,1));
ot = this.Datatype;
if (this.Datatype==1) {
- this.model.sim = list("summation",4);
+ this.model.sim = list(new ScilabString("summation"),new ScilabDouble(4));
} else if (this.Datatype==2) {
- this.model.sim = list("summation_z",4);
+ this.model.sim = list(new ScilabString("summation_z"),new ScilabDouble(4));
} else if (((this.Datatype<1)||(this.Datatype>8))) {
message("Datatype is not supported");
ok = false;
} else {
if (this.satur==0) {
if (this.Datatype==3) {
- this.model.sim = list("summation_i32n",4);
+ this.model.sim = list(new ScilabString("summation_i32n"),new ScilabDouble(4));
} else if (this.Datatype==4) {
- this.model.sim = list("summation_i16n",4);
+ this.model.sim = list(new ScilabString("summation_i16n"),new ScilabDouble(4));
} else if (this.Datatype==5) {
- this.model.sim = list("summation_i8n",4);
+ this.model.sim = list(new ScilabString("summation_i8n"),new ScilabDouble(4));
} else if (this.Datatype==6) {
- this.model.sim = list("summation_ui32n",4);
+ this.model.sim = list(new ScilabString("summation_ui32n"),new ScilabDouble(4));
} else if (this.Datatype==7) {
- this.model.sim = list("summation_ui16n",4);
+ this.model.sim = list(new ScilabString("summation_ui16n"),new ScilabDouble(4));
} else if (this.Datatype==8) {
- this.model.sim = list("summation_ui8n",4);
+ this.model.sim = list(new ScilabString("summation_ui8n"),new ScilabDouble(4));
}
} else if (this.satur==1) {
if (this.Datatype==3) {
- this.model.sim = list("summation_i32s",4);
+ this.model.sim = list(new ScilabString("summation_i32s"),new ScilabDouble(4));
} else if (this.Datatype==4) {
- this.model.sim = list("summation_i16s",4);
+ this.model.sim = list(new ScilabString("summation_i16s"),new ScilabDouble(4));
} else if (this.Datatype==5) {
- this.model.sim = list("summation_i8s",4);
+ this.model.sim = list(new ScilabString("summation_i8s"),new ScilabDouble(4));
} else if (this.Datatype==6) {
- this.model.sim = list("summation_ui32s",4);
+ this.model.sim = list(new ScilabString("summation_ui32s"),new ScilabDouble(4));
} else if (this.Datatype==7) {
- this.model.sim = list("summation_ui16s",4);
+ this.model.sim = list(new ScilabString("summation_ui16s"),new ScilabDouble(4));
} else if (this.Datatype==8) {
- this.model.sim = list("summation_ui8s",4);
+ this.model.sim = list(new ScilabString("summation_ui8s"),new ScilabDouble(4));
}
} else if (this.satur==2) {
if (this.Datatype==3) {
- this.model.sim = list("summation_i32e",4);
+ this.model.sim = list(new ScilabString("summation_i32e"),new ScilabDouble(4));
} else if (this.Datatype==4) {
- this.model.sim = list("summation_i16e",4);
+ this.model.sim = list(new ScilabString("summation_i16e"),new ScilabDouble(4));
} else if (this.Datatype==5) {
- this.model.sim = list("summation_i8e",4);
+ this.model.sim = list(new ScilabString("summation_i8e"),new ScilabDouble(4));
} else if (this.Datatype==6) {
- this.model.sim = list("summation_ui32e",4);
+ this.model.sim = list(new ScilabString("summation_ui32e"),new ScilabDouble(4));
} else if (this.Datatype==7) {
- this.model.sim = list("summation_ui16e",4);
+ this.model.sim = list(new ScilabString("summation_ui16e"),new ScilabDouble(4));
} else if (this.Datatype==8) {
- this.model.sim = list("summation_ui8e",4);
+ this.model.sim = list(new ScilabString("summation_ui8e"),new ScilabDouble(4));
}
}
}